“Most notifications you get are because a machine is trying to get your attention. Those notifications aren't built to help you live your life. They're built to get your attention.”

Tristan Harris

About This Quote

Source Talk: 2016 TED Talk “How a handful of tech companies control billions of minds every day”

The quote warns that many digital alerts are designed to capture attention rather than serve user wellbeing.

In simple terms: Tech alerts aim to grab focus, not improve life.
